How Do I Install Microsoft Security Essentials on Server 2012?

Microsoft Security Essentials is a free anti-malware program that offers essential protection against malware for Windows Server 2012. To install Microsoft Security Essentials on Server 2012, download the installation file, MSEInstall.exe.

Once you have downloaded the file, you will need to change the Compatibility property for the file. To do this, right-click on the file and select Properties from the drop-down menu. In the Properties window, click on the Compatibility tab and check the box next to Run this program in compatibility mode.

Select Windows Server 2012 from the drop-down menu and click Apply. Lastly, you must install MSEInstall.exe with the command parameter MSEInstall.exe /disables the limit.

Once you have done all this, Microsoft Security Essentials should be installed on your server and offer basic protection against malware.
